In late January 2023, we sat down to speak with Scott Dicker of SPINS, a wellness-focused data technology company that provides retail consumer insights and analytics, with a focus in the natural, organic, and specialty products industries.
Gathering Market Insights at SPINS
Scott is their director of market insights, and has a special love for sports nutrition products, as he’s a long-time user in the category. We first met him at SupplySide West 2022, where he and Ben both gave presentations in the Sports Nutrition’s Rebound and Regrowth session.
When we needed a quote about the growth of collagen over the past few years, we called on Scott to provide it. This led to us inviting him onto the podcast, which was a great conversation about data, trends, the economy, energy drinks, and some of Scott’s own personal predictions for the coming years.
On the record: Scott answers the call for collagen data
To support a claim made in our recent Ingredient Optimized ioCollagen announcement, we asked Scott to talk to us about collagen’s growth. He replied with the following:
“Collagen continues to expand it’s reach, both in protein powders as well as in functional food and beverages. When looking at protein powders, collagen now has the second largest market share on Amazon, only behind whey protein. While sales and unit both stagnated on Amazon this past year, brick and mortar sales grew by almost 24%. This is especially impressive since units also increased by double digits. This separates collagen from most other categories where sales growth was largely driven by inflation and rising prices. Collagen has really benefited from the diversity of merchandising opportunities that retailers are providing, often found in both the beauty and personal care section as well as supplements. I expect collagen to have another strong year, even in this uncertain economy.”
– Scott Dicker, Market Insights Director for SPINS

#078: Dr. Ralf Jaeger - ATP for Nitric Oxide, Blood Flow, & Performance
Show notes posted at https://blog.priceplow.com/podcast/dr-ralf-jaeger-atp-078
On December 28, 2022, we had the honor of hosting Dr. Ralf Jaeger to the PricePlow Podcast. For Episode #078, we dove into all things ATP — adenosine triphosphate — and how supplementing more with Peak ATP (sold and distributed by TSI Group) can improve workout performance — but not in the way most individuals expect.
Dr. Ralf Jaeger: Using Peak ATP to improve blood flow
Peak ATP provides exogenous ATP as a disodium ATP salt, which is the most stable form. While many think of ATP as the “energy currency” of all living cells, it’s also a signaling molecule. When supplementing, its real effects take advantage of that mechanism: Dr. Jaeger explains that ATP signals greater nitric oxide release, thereby improving blood flow.
This is especially helpful to take before intense exercise, as ATP stores get used up quickly and the body needs to generate more. Low ATP levels means low performance.

A note regarding ATP and calcium release
Around the 8-minute mark in this episode, Dr. Jaeger mentioned that ATP increases calcium release, which aids in muscle contraction. We didn’t dive any deeper, but later asked for some supporting references when writing these show notes.
He provided two studies, adding the following:
Under conditions of fatigue oxygen availability and calcium release may decline in skeletal muscle. When this occurs red blood cells respond by releasing ATP into the blood, which triggers vasodilation, localized blood flow, enhanced nutrient uptake, and sustained muscle excitability by increasing extracellular uptake of calcium.
— Dr. Ralf Jaeger (via email)
He added that 50% decrease in calcium release = 80% reduced force, which comes from the second of those two studies provided (see Figure 5).
Closing up: ATP is more than energy
We’d like to thank Dr. Ralf for coming on, and to TSI Group for connecting us and funding his time and this episode.
In summary, the point here is that ATP is often discussed in the context of cellular energy but not as much in terms of signaling. And it turns out that its role in signaling for greater nitric oxide during exercise is potentially more relevant to our user base (sports nutrition researchers and performance athletes).

Impel IN Daily – Greens & Longevity
The goal here is to add ingredients into a daily greens formula that will reduce the number of capsules required from other supplements.
For instance, turmeric/curcumin (anti-inflammatory), NAC (antioxidant/immunity), Astrion (skin care), Coenzyme Q10 (antioxidant / cardiovascular health), and PQQ (cellular energy) knock out ton of things that you’d likely have to take on your own, since they’re rarely in multivitamins but are incredibly healthy on a daily basis. Even you use even a few of these on a daily basis, it’s a great idea to switch.

Brent Laffey of Armada Nutrition — a premier contract supplement manufacturer — re-joins the PricePlow Podcast to talk about Armada’s expansion. Armada is well-known for producing some of the world’s most popular supplements in their highly-acclaimed Tennessee facility, but now they’re expanding with an even larger facility in Salt Lake City, Utah.
We bring Brent onto the show to talk about Armada’s history, its other closely-related businesses (such as Prinova of the NAGASE group), supplement technologies such as blending, and the extraordinary amount of testing Armada performs on the products they produce. Then we get into the Utah expansion, which marks a major upgrade in the company’s capabilities and throughput. Along the way, you’ll learn about flavor technology, industry careers, and even types of dairy used in different whey proteins.
